has anyone experienced absesses in the heel? My horse has been on box rest for the past 5 weeks with laminitis and recently became very lame on his right foreleg it was really hot and swollEn. I then noticed what looks like an absess on his heel. I phoned vet and farrier and both gave me same advice. However I have looked through books and online and I've not come accross anything on absesses on the heel.

My work's driving pony had a massive heel abscess after laminitis. It confused everyone for a while and took ages to burst. The vet and farrier said that abscesses often follow laminitis but that they tend to be around the toes and only occasionally in the heels.

ETA Get the vet or farrier to have a dig for it then you can tub and poultice

I have found that hand walking on tarmac can help the absess to burst. The biggest problem is making sure that you keep in clean afterwards in the stable etc
